Iso-Phase Busduct (IPB)

Specifically designed for power plant and large switching station applications, the All-
welded isolated phase busduct provides reliable operation with a minimum of
maintenance.

This design eliminates common problems in connecting main generators to main
transformers, unit transformers and auxiliary equipment in generating stations.




Each phase is mounted in individual enclosures. Conductors are air insulated and
supported in the center phase enclosures by strategically arranged insulators. Phase-to-
phase short circuits are eliminated and no current is induced in the steelwork, cables,
pipes or other metal structures in close proximity to the bus.

The system is electrically continuous with all three phase enclosures bonded at the
generator and transformer ends. The induced current flow in each is equal to the
conductor current flow, but in an opposite direction. As a result, there is no flux external
to the enclosure and no risk of current loss due to damaging inductive heating. Shielding
provided by the enclosure reduces magnetic forces on conductors and stress on
insulators as well.

Non-Segregated Phase Busduct (NSPB)

Our outsourced Non-Segregated Phase Busduct has been designed to meet specific
installation requirements for reliable power distribution.

Typical of such applications are the connections from transformers to switchgear
assemblies in substations, connections from switchgear lineup to generators, and tie
connections between switchgear to switchgear.

Non-Segregated Phase Busduct is an assembly of bus conductors with associated
connections, joints and insulating supports enclosed within a metal enclosure without
inter-phase barriers.

Because of its compact dimensions, relative light weight, and user-friendly design, non-
segregated phase bus duct is easy to install.

Segregated Phase Busduct (SPB)

Our outsourced Segregated Phase Busduct has a good short circuit withstand capability.

Enclosures are fabricated from aluminum as standard to have better heat dissipation
and also eliminating the eddy current effect throughout the busduct run. Enclosures are
welded for maximum rigidity. Removable covers are secured with bolts for ease of
access when making joints and subsequent periodic inspections.

Enclosures are painted with a baked-on polyester powder coat paint system resulting in
a very durable finish with uniform thickness and gloss.

The standard color is RAL7032 light gray. Special paint colors are available upon request.

Product Features
- Standard aluminum housing provides durability and product integrity
- Standard finish is a baked on epoxy powder coating, which provides excellent
mechanical strength, is scratch resistant and resists chalking caused by ultraviolet
rays.
- An epoxy insulation process ensures optimum conductor protection reducing the
possibility of corona and electrical tracking.
- Copper or Aluminum busbar with all joint surfaces tin or silver plated to ensure
maximum conductivity through the joints.
- Product design and manufacturing meets requirements of IEC, GB and JB standards.
- A full family of fittings and accessories to meet any application requirements.
- High short circuit ratings optimize coordination between bus duct and power
equipment
- Easy installation allows for a lower installation cost in comparison to power cable.
